Low-Code: O futuro e a democratização da tecnologia 🚀
Introdução
Cria aplicações e sistemas era algo que exigia de desenvolvedores sêniores, com anos de experiência em linguagens complexas. Hoje, com Low-Code prova que a tecnologia pode ser acessível a todos.
Com Low-Code oferece interfaces visuais prontas onde você só precisa organizar suas ideias e transformar em aplicações, sem precisar de grande conhecimento de programação. Ferramentas como Lovable, Make e LangFlow são exemplos que estão democratizando o desenvolvimento e acelerando a revolução digital.
O que é Low-Code ? 🌍
O Low-Code é uma forma de desenvolvimento que permite criar aplicações com pouco código manual, usando principalmente interfaces visuais, componentes prontos e automações. Parecido com Scratch, juntando peças como se fosse um quebra-cabeça. A ideia é facilitar e acelerar o desenvolvimento, tornando possível que (profissionais de negócio, analistas, ou qualquer pessoa sem grande conhecimento em programação) também consigam criar soluções.
Claro que não substitui os desenvolvedores, é o caminho que pode unir os conceitos da programação tradicional com a agilidade do Low-Code, entregando resultados rápidos, diminuindo o tempo de desenvolvimento, permitindo fazer testes na aplicação antes de entregar para o cliente. Ampliando desenvolvimento ágil e focando na resolução de problemas mais complexos.

Fonte: Creatio
Características principais do Low-code 💻
- Interface visual : ferramentas de arrastar e soltar componentes como formulários, botões e gráficos.
- Modelagem declarativa: foco em definir o que o sistema deve fazer.
- Integrações fáceis: conectores prontos para bancos de dados, APIs, ERPs, CRMs, etc.
- Automação: fluxos de trabalho (workflows) e modelos que simplificam as tarefas.
- Customização com código: se necessário, pode-se adicionar código tradicional (JavaScript, Python, C#, etc.).
Setores que mais usam Low-code 🏙️
- Saúde → agendamento de consultas, telemedicina, gestão de pacientes.
- Educação → portais de alunos, gestão de notas, matrícula online.
- Indústria → controle de estoque, chão de fábrica, manutenção preditiva.
- Financeiro → onboarding de clientes, análise de crédito, automação de compliance.
- E-commerce → apps de catálogo, carrinho de compras, suporte automatizado.
Benefícios 💪
- Aceleração no desenvolvimento
- Redução de custos
- Democratização da criação de apps
- Fácil manutenção e escalabilidade
- Melhora a inovação
- Autonomia e Flexibilidade
Conclusão ✍️
O Low-Code é o futuro do desenvolvimento. É a chance de transformar ideias em soluções que impactam comunidades, empresas e pessoas e além de ser acessível a todos. Onde com pouca experiência em programação podemos entregar projetos incríveis para os clientes e de uma forma muita mais rápida.
Com essa revolução na tecnologia. fica uma pergunta: Você acredita que o Low-Code é o futuro?
Vamos juntos inspirar pessoas e comunidades! Deixe seu comentário, compartilhe.




Muito interessante, Henrique! Seu artigo sobre Low-Code oferece uma excelente visão sobre como essa abordagem está moldando o futuro do desenvolvimento e tornando a tecnologia mais acessível a todos. A forma como você destacou as ferramentas como Lovable, Make e LangFlow realmente ilustra a democratização do desenvolvimento, permitindo que pessoas de diferentes áreas e com pouco conhecimento técnico possam criar soluções inovadoras de maneira ágil.
Eu gostei muito de como você explicou as principais características do Low-Code, como as interfaces visuais e a modelagem declarativa, o que facilita a criação de aplicações e acelera a entrega. Você também fez uma boa conexão entre Low-Code e a agilidade no desenvolvimento, mostrando que, embora não substitua os desenvolvedores, ele os capacita a focar em problemas mais complexos e inovadores.
Na DIO, acreditamos muito nesse movimento de democratização da tecnologia, e você conseguiu transmitir claramente esse poder transformador do Low-Code. Agora, me conta: você acredita que, com a popularização do Low-Code, haverá uma diminuição da dependência de desenvolvedores sêniores para soluções mais simples, ou ainda haverá um equilíbrio entre os dois?